About
- Martha Phillips joined the firm in 1986 after receiving her Juris Doctorate degree from the University of Tulsa College of Law
- Ms. Phillips was the first female partner in the firm and concentrates her practice in medical malpractice defense issues and personal injury and products liability litigation
- Prior to law school, Ms. Phillips obtained her B.S. degree from Oklahoma State University and earned her certification as a Medical Technologist from the American Society of Clinical Pathologists
- For several years she was involved in clinical cancer research and served as supervisor of the pediatric hematology/oncology laboratory at Children’s Hospital in Oklahoma City
- In 1978, she graduated with honors as a Physician Assistant from the University of Oklahoma Health Sciences Center in Oklahoma City
- That same year she received her license and certification as a Physician Assistant
